Sweden - Export of Parts for Aircraft Spark-Ignition Reciprocating or Rotary Internal Combustion Piston Engines
Since 2014, Sweden Export of Parts for Aircraft Spark-Ignition Reciprocating or Rotary Internal Combustion Piston Engines was down by 5.3%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 15 comparing other countries in Export of Parts for Aircraft Spark-Ignition Reciprocating or Rotary Internal Combustion Piston Engines with €272,778. Sweden is overtaken by Portugal, which was ranked number 14 with €562,386 and is followed by Hungary with €229,209. United Kingdom topped the ranking with €78,800,650.41 in 2019, a decrease of 1.3% compared to 2018. Poland, Italy and Romania resp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Slovenia witnessed the best average annual growth at +131.1% per year, while Cyprus was the worst growing country at -100% per year.
